Presenting features include somnolence, stupor, psychomotor retardation, Sober living house slurred speech, mood changes (euphoria followed by dysphoria), respiratory depression, and impaired memory and attention. The intensity of these symptoms is related to the amount of opioids consumed, and in severe intoxication, coma may occur. These symptoms are not better accounted by the presence of another medical condition or presence of intoxication or withdrawal of another substance. Opioid overdose is a related life-threatening condition induced by consumption of excess amounts of opioids, which is characterized by pinpoint pupils, unconsciousness, and respiratory depression.

Alcohol is a generic term for ethanol, which is a particular type of alcohol produced by the fermentation of many foodstuffs – most commonly barley, hops, and grapes. Other types of alcohol commonly available such as methanol (common in glass cleaners), isopropyl alcohol (rubbing alcohol), and ethylene glycol (automobile antifreeze solution) are highly poisonous when swallowed, even in small quantities.

Physiological changes in pregnancy often lead to unpredictable variations in the pharmacokinetics of drugs, making most medications and psychoactive substances risky. Despite this knowledge, global prevalence of substance use among pregnant women is about 6%, maximal among young pregnant women (18.3% among pregnant women aged 15–17 years). Pregnant women with intoxication present a challenging situation for the emergency department, as both the mother and the fetus are in need of medical attention, and medications need to be used with great caution.
